Bacon-Wrapped Maple Balsamic Chicken and Veggie Skewers

These bacon-wrapped chicken skewers combine tender marinated chicken with colorful vegetables, all wrapped in crispy bacon and glazed with a sweet maple balsamic marinade. The chicken is cut into cubes and marinated with red onions in a mixture of olive oil, balsamic vinegar, maple syrup, and fresh thyme. Cherry tomatoes and yellow peppers add freshness and vibrant color. Perfect for summer barbecues, outdoor gatherings, or weeknight dinners when you want something special. The bacon keeps the chicken moist while adding smoky flavor, and the maple balsamic combination creates a delicious sweet and tangy glaze.

Ingredients

  • 4 skinless chicken breasts, cut into 2-inch cubes

  • 2 small red onions, cut into quarters
  • 8 slices bacon
  • 12 cherry tomatoes
  • 2 yellow peppers, cut into quarters

  • 3 tbsp olive oil
  • 2 tbsp balsamic vinegar
  • 1 tbsp fresh thyme, chopped

  • 1 tbsp maple syrup

  • salt and pepper, to taste

Instructions

  1. 1

    Mix marinade ingredients in a small bowl

  2. 2

    Stir chicken with red onions into marinade, cover, and refrigerate for at least 30 minutes or overnight

  3. 3

    Soak wooden skewers in water for 30 minutes and oil the grill

  4. 4

    Preheat barbecue to medium-high heat

  5. 5

    Drain chicken and red onions and discard marinade

  6. 6

    Thread skewers using two bacon slices and three to four chicken cubes per skewer, wrapping bacon around chicken and weaving over vegetables, alternating chicken and veggies with small gaps between ingredients

  7. 7

    Place skewers on grill and close lid

  8. 8

    Cook for five minutes, then turn over and cook another five minutes or until chicken is no longer pink inside

  9. 9

    Serve immediately

Tips

Tip 1

Marinate the chicken overnight for deeper flavor penetration and more tender results.

Tip 2

Keep bacon slightly undercooked when wrapping since it will finish cooking on the grill.

Tip 3

Cut vegetables similar in size to chicken cubes for even cooking throughout the skewer.

Good to Know

Storage

Refrigerate cooked skewers for up to 3 days in airtight container.

Make Ahead

Marinate chicken and prep vegetables up to 24 hours ahead. Assemble skewers morning of cooking.

Serve With

Serve immediately off the grill with rice, quinoa, or grilled bread.

Common Mistakes

Watch

Soak wooden skewers to avoid burning on the grill.

Watch

Don't overcrowd ingredients to ensure even cooking.

FAQ

Can I use metal skewers instead of wooden ones?

Yes, metal skewers work great and don't need soaking. Just be careful as they get very hot during grilling.

What if I don't have a grill?

You can cook these in the oven at 425°F for 15-20 minutes or use a grill pan on the stovetop over medium-high heat.

How long will leftover skewers keep?

Cooked skewers will keep in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. Reheat gently in the oven or microwave.
